What do you mean by Consistent Dividends providing Company's ?


A consistent dividend-paying company is a company that has a history of paying dividends to its shareholders on a regular basis, typically quarterly or annually. These companies prioritize sharing their profits with shareholders in the form of dividends, providing a relatively stable source of income.

Characteristics of Consistent Dividend-Paying Company's

1. _Dividend Yield_: Consistent dividend-paying companies typically have a higher dividend yield, which is the ratio of the annual dividend payment to the stock's current price

2. _Dividend Payout Ratio_: These companies usually have a sustainable dividend payout ratio, which is the percentage of earnings paid out as dividends.

3. _History of Dividend Payments_: Consistent dividend-paying companies have a long history of paying dividends, often with a consistent or increasing dividend payout over time.

4. _Financial Stability_: These companies typically have strong financials, including a stable cash flow, low debt, and a solid balance sheet.

Benefits of Investing in Consistent Dividend-Paying Company's

1. _Regular Income Stream_: Consistent dividend-paying companies provide a regular income stream, which can help investors meet their living expenses or reinvest the dividends to grow their wealth.

2. _Lower Volatility_: These companies tend to be less volatile, as the dividend payout provides a relatively stable source of return.

3. _Inflation Protection_: Dividend-paying companies can provide a hedge against inflation, as the dividend payout can increase over time to keep pace with inflation.

4. _Long-Term Wealth Creation_: Consistent dividend-paying companies can contribute to long-term wealth creation, as the dividend payout can be reinvested to purchase additional shares.

Examples of Consistent Dividend-Paying Companies in Indian

1. _Hindustan Unilever Limited (HUL)_: HUL has a long history of paying consistent dividends and has increased its dividend payout over the years.

2. _Indian Oil Corporation Limited (IOCL)_: IOCL has been paying consistent dividends for several years and has a strong track record of dividend payments.

3. _Tata Consultancy Services Limited (TCS)_: TCS has a history of paying consistent dividends and has increased its dividend payout over the years.

4. _Coal India Limited (CIL)_: CIL has been paying consistent dividends for several years and has a strong track record of dividend payments.

Things to Consider When Investing in Consistent Dividend-Paying Company's

1. _Dividend Yield vs. Growth Potential_: Consider the trade-off between dividend yield and growth potential when investing in consistent dividend-paying companies.

2. _Sustainability of Dividend Payments_: Evaluate the company's ability to sustain its dividend payments over time, considering factors like cash flow, debt, and industry trends.

3. _Valuation_: Consider the company's valuation, including its price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io and dividend yield, to ensure it's reasonably priced.

In conclusion, consistent dividend-paying companies can provide a relatively stable source of income and contribute to long-term wealth creation. However, it's essential to evaluate these companies carefully, considering factors like dividend yield, sustainability of dividend payments, and valuation.
